The GEF Independent Evaluation Office is holding the 4th conference integration between environmental domains, and between environmental and socioeconomic and policy domains, and what this means for evaluation. The objective is to bring together experts and young evaluators to share experiences and inform future evaluation practice, with outcomes disseminated through webinars and a book.

UNEG EPE session: Integrating Environment into Evaluations
Starting Date: Tuesday, November 16, 2021 Location: Online The 2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development is a plan of action for people, planet and prosperity. The attendant Sustainable Development Goals rest on three equally important pillars, the economic, social and environmental. In practice, however, the environmental dimension is often treated as an afterthought when it comes to policies, programs and evaluation. |
Registration Open for IOE (IFAD) Side Event at COP 26
Starting Date: Monday, October 25, 2021 Location: Online On 4 November 2021 from 9:00 - 10:00 GMT, the Independent Office of Evaluation (IOE) of IFAD will host the side event Evidence-based transformative pathways for smallholder farmers’ resilience to climate change. In collaboration with the evaluation units of GCF and DEval, the event will be anchored around evidence emerging from IOE’s recent Thematic Evaluation of IFAD’s support to small holder farmers’ adaptation to climate change, as well as evaluations of IEU of GCF and DEval. |
